I am no recruiting expert, nor am I any kind of person with sources. I was just looking around at the best players in the country for the 11' class and decided to gather as much of a list as I can for guys with offers/interest from UT. These are the guys we are looking that have the highest ratings that I could find

2's/3's
Kentavious Caldwell, 6-3, 170
Greenville (GA) Greenville

Adonis Thomas 6-6, 205
Memphis (TN) Melrose

LaQuinton Ross 6-6. 195
Jackson (MS) Murrah

Jeremiah Davis 6-3, 195
Muncie (IN) Muncie Central

Cedrick McAfee 6-3, 175
Memphis (TN) Craigmont

Jacoby Brissett 6-5, 225
West Palm Beach (FL) Dwyer

Kedren Johnson 6-4 200
Lewisburg (TN) Marshall County

PG

Kevin Ware 6-4, 170 (Solid UT Committ)
Conyers (GA) Rockdale County

Quinn Cook 6-1, 180
Hyattsville (MD) DeMatha

Chris Jones 5-10 160
Memphis (TN) Melrose

(There are very few PG's, probably because the staff is sold on Ware, and Golden, while good, is not a one-n-done kinda player).

PF/Combo Forwards

Quincy Miller 6-8, 193
Winston-Salem (NC) Quality Education Academy

Chane Behanan 6-7, 225
Bowling Green (KY) Bowling Green

Octavious Ellis 6-8, 185
Memphis (TN) Whitehaven

Thomas Gipson 6-7, 255
Cedar Hill (TX) Cedar Hill

Henry Brooks 6-8, 215
Lithonia (GA) Miller Grove

Levon Harper 6-8, 226
Farmville (VA) Fuqua School

Like I said, I don't know who we are going to get, or how good these players are, I just wanted to get a list with guys we are interested in. Hope this is some use to you guys.

Unfortunately it remains very difficult to pull anyone out of Memphis, but White Station is where both Dane Bradshaw and JP Prince went so it should be the closest thing we have to a high school there were going to UT is okay. Whitehaven and Melrose are totally different animals.

Cedrick Wilson came from Melrose high and people were not kind about it but they understood. He wanted NFL money (which he got) and playing QB at Memphis would never have taken him as far as coming to UT and being a WR.

Also from Melrose was Tony Harris. That guy would be a hero in Memphis still if he had gone there, but he decided to come to Knoxville. He was greeted with so much hate when they came back to play the Tigers that it served notice to lots of other Memphis kids not to come to UT for any reason.

Pastner will also take whoever he wants it looks like from Memphis. He is going to have hometown boys in starring roles the next two years and he has great relationships with the HS coaches.

Also Easterwood is the idiot and jerk who is a Nike whore and an attention whore coaching lots of good AAU players in Memphis. He is the guy who complained about the hostess rubbing her boobs on his son. He is bitter because UT did not give his son a scholarship and I think he is playing at Cumberland County or something.

Sorry for the doom and gloom on Memphis.

The good news is that UT has awesome connections now in Georgia, UT has some football recruits they will probably miss on at Dwyer this year but they may get one in the same class from the same HS as the bball recruit we are after. UT is also starting to get great connections in NYC area. If we keep NYC ballers and Atlanta ballers we can afford to miss on Memphis.
